Important Mensuration Topics for CAT

Various shapes and formulas for their curved surface area, total surface area, and volume are given below:

Name of Shape

Explanation

Curved Surface Area

Total Surface Area

Volume

Cube

All the sides of a cube are equal, and suppose that the length of each side in a cube is ‘a’.

4a2

6a2

a3

Cuboid

Let the length, breadth, and height of the cuboid be ‘l’, ‘b’, and ‘h’, respectively.

2 (l + b) h

2 (lb + bh + hl)

lbh

Right Circular Cylinder

Let the radius of the cylinder be ‘r’, and the height be ‘h’.

2πrh

2πr(h + r)

πr2h

Right Circular Cone

Let the radius of the cone be ‘r’, and the perpendicular height from vertex to base be ‘h’. Let the length of the cone be ‘l’.

πrl

πr(l + r)

(⅓)π r2h

Sphere

Let the radius of the sphere be ‘r’.

4πr2

4πr2

4/3)πr3

Solid Hemisphere

Let the radius of the sphere be ‘r’.

2πr2

3πr2

2/3πr3

Hollow Hemisphere

Let the radius of the shape be ‘r’.

2πr2

2πr2

2/3πr3

4. Is geometry different from mensuration?

Geometry is the study of the relationship between points, lines, surfaces, etc., along with its properties, while mensuration is the measurement of the perimeter, area, volume, etc, of shapes.
